What "fast" must and should not mean

Most companies now market fast first aid, express first aid, or fast cpr courses. The label itself does not tell you a lot. The trick is what has been reduced, and how.

There are 3 common ways a course is made "fast" without sacrificing excessive quality:

First, some theory is relocated online. A mixed first aid and CPR course will certainly ask you to finish e‑learning ahead of time, then concentrate the class time on CPR training, bandaging, use an AED, and technique scenarios. The overall understanding time is comparable, yet the face‑to‑face day is shorter.

Second, the course range is narrower. A short express CPR course or fast cpr correspondence course could cover just cardiopulmonary resuscitation and defibrillator use, without subjects such as burns, fractures, or ecological emergency situations. For some roles this is proper. For others it is not.

Third, the team size is kept tiny and the timetable is tight. A focused team with a good trainer can finish a complete first aid and CPR course much faster than a huge, slow‑moving course full of side conversations.

Red flags appear when "fast first aid course" translates to rushed presentations, little hands‑on practice, and analyses that seem like a box‑ticking workout. When someone is not breathing, rate will not assist you if you can not remember exactly how to position your hands or what deepness of compressions to intend for.

If you are drawn to express first aid courses due to time stress, that is understandable. The trick is to comprehend exactly what you are trading for that shorter timetable.

What a rewarding first aid course actually covers

Before contrasting "fast" options, it aids to recognize what a first aid sessions near me strong first aid training day should consist of. Names vary by provider, however the core aspects of a skilled first aid and CPR course often tend to be similar.

At minimum, a basic first aid course for area participants must cover:

    Recognising an emergency, checking for threat, and requiring help CPR training on grownups, consisting of compressions and rescue breaths or hands‑only CPR, depending on guidelines Use of a computerized outside defibrillator (AED) Management of choking in adults and children Control of severe blood loss and shock Basic take care of burns, cracks, and sprains Dealing with subconscious yet breathing casualties, including the recovery position Recognition of heart attack, stroke, and anaphylaxis, and how to support the person till sophisticated aid arrives

Courses that state "first aid and cpr training classes" need to likewise include practical sessions where you really kneel close to a manikin and execute compressions, not simply enjoy an instructor.

Specialised teams need more. An express childcare first aid course, for example, ought to include infant CPR, management of usual youth injuries, allergies, and asthma, plus demo of how to keep a damaged kid calmness and secure. Express child care first aid training that does not offer you time to practice baby CPR several times is not offering you.

When you see "fast first aid courses" marketed greatly, ask on your own: could all of that be meaningfully covered while marketed, with 8 to 12 individuals practising and asking concerns? If the response feels doubtful, dig deeper.

Certificates, accreditation, and what they really mean

Many individuals are chasing after a first aid certificate since their employer, regulator, or expert body needs one. In that context, not all certifications are equal.

Reputable first aid and CPR courses are commonly lined up with national or local guidelines. Depending on your nation, that could indicate recognition by a government authority, a work environment safety and security regulatory authority, or a significant voluntary help organisation.

Look for 3 things:

Accreditation or recognition. For office roles, a fast first aid course need to satisfy the relevant work health and wellness or childcare standards in your region. If the web site is obscure, call and ask which criterion the certificate straightens with.

image

Assessment with actual requirements. To issue a reputable first aid certificate, the carrier ought to examine you versus clear results such as CPR strategy, safe use of an AED, and fundamental wound management. This does not require to seem like an exam, however it should be more than just signing the participation sheet.

Clear expiry and refresher guidance. CPR skills weaken swiftly, which is why many organisations require CPR refresher training every twelve month, even if the more comprehensive first aid certification lasts 2 or 3 years. Well run fast cpr correspondence course will certainly concentrate nearly completely on compressions, rescue breaths if ideal, and AED procedure, with repeated practice.

Fast certification is attractive, but if you later uncover that the certificate is declined by your company or professional board, you have actually shed both time and money.

Different layouts of "fast" first aid and CPR training

Once you understand the content you require, you can think of format. Several "fast first aid training" offers currently fall into one of a few categories.

Blended courses. These combine self‑paced online components with a much shorter useful session. For instance, you may complete 3 hours of e‑learning after that go to a three‑hour face‑to‑face class concentrated on CPR training, AED usage, and hands‑on bandaging. For grownups who fit with on the internet knowing and can discipline themselves to finish it, this is an efficient format.

Short, concentrated CPR courses. A 90‑minute express cpr course or fast cpr session is usually intended as a stand‑alone CPR and AED update or an introductory neighborhood course. It is best for offices where multiple people simply need confidence in heart emergencies, or for member of the family of somebody with cardiovascular disease. It is not a full first aid course.

Express first aid days. Some organisations provide a one‑day express first aid course that covers both first aid and CPR, making use of a mix of pre‑reading and extensive class work. The day is full, yet you walk out with both first aid and cpr certification.

On site group training. For workplaces or clubs, carriers will certainly often press some elements by customizing situations especially to your atmosphere. An express first aid training session supplied in your own facility can feel quicker due to the fact that you are practising in the very same rooms where emergency situations may occur.

Purely on-line first aid courses. These can be valuable for academic knowledge or as refresher courses between official courses, yet they can not change hands‑on CPR training if your function includes obligation for others. Be wary of any kind of provider using a full first aid certificate based solely on watching video clips and answering quizzes.

The right layout depends upon your schedule, your understanding design, and just how important practical skills remain in your context. A blended or express option can be the best of both worlds if you take the pre‑course work seriously.

How to check out course descriptions like an instructor

After years of teaching, I can generally distinguish a course pamphlet whether I would more than happy to teach there. You can utilize similar hints as a possible student.

When a fast first aid course summary is significant, it will certainly chat concretely regarding skills. For example, "execute uninterrupted upper body compressions for 2 mins" carries more weight than "discover CPR". Search for verbs like "perform", "show", and "apply" as opposed to just "recognize" or "be aware of".

Pay interest to just how scenario technique is explained. Great first aid training consists of some form of sensible circumstance: handling an unconscious individual, dealing with an extreme hemorrhage while one more student calls emergency situation services, or handling a choking kid role‑play. If the timetable is only talks and video clips, there is little area for building muscle mass memory.

An express cpr training session that still permits each participant a number of full cycles of compressions on a manikin, with comments from the trainer, can be much more useful than a much longer course where half the course simply watches.

Be mindful if the marketing factor is primarily regarding being easy, quick, and calling for little effort. First aid and cpr courses ought to be accessible, however they are additionally about preparing you for the most awful day somebody near you might have. Some sense of difficulty is appropriate.

Special instance: picking express child care initial aid

Childcare specialists usually have the hardest combination of restrictions: strict governing needs, long working hours, and the emotional weight of being responsible for other people's children.

When examining express childcare first aid courses, be especially mindful that "express" describes the timetable, not to a minimized content list that no more meets regulative standards.

Key points to confirm include:

Infant and kid CPR in addition to grown-up CPR, with duplicated technique for both.

Management of choking in infants and children, including what to do if the kid comes to be unconscious.

Recognition and response to common paediatric emergencies such as bronchial asthma assaults, anaphylaxis, seizures, head injuries, and severe bleeding.

Clear advice on when to call moms and dads, when to call emergency solutions, and just how to record incidents in a childcare context.

Express childcare first aid training need to additionally acknowledge the emotional side. Handling an actual emergency entailing a child is difficult. Instructors that have actually collaborated with youngsters themselves can frequently share practical pointers for staying tranquil and maintaining the group of other children risk-free at the very same time.

If a service provider markets express childcare first aid courses however just details grown-up subjects, maintain looking.

Keeping abilities sharp after a fast course

No issue how good the fast first aid course is, abilities discolor. Data differ, yet many studies recommend that CPR performance weakens substantially within 6 to twelve month without technique. That is why normal fast cpr correspondence course are so valuable.

You can also reinforce abilities in between formal courses by:

Reviewing your course manual or trusted on the internet sources every few months, especially the steps for CPR and choking.

Mentally practicing what you would perform in acquainted rooms, such as your office, health club, or home. Where is the nearest AED? How would you clear the location and require help?

Practising non‑technical skills such as steadly offering directions or entrusting a person to satisfy the ambulance.

If you ever before need to use your abilities in an actual occurrence, take into consideration reserving an early refresher. People commonly uncover knowledge voids just when evaluated by reality.
